Fishbone (Ishikawa) Diagram Generator

Generate a Fishbone (Ishikawa) cause-and-effect diagram from a problem statement and 3-6 cause categories. Produces a publication-quality SVG.

What it produces

A publication-quality SVG file with:

  • Problem statement as the "head" (right side of the fish)
  • 3-6 cause categories (default: 6M — Man, Machine, Material, Method, Measurement, Environment; customisable)
  • 2-5 individual causes per category
  • Color-coded bones (orange = material, blue = method, etc.)
  • Title + date stamp
  • 5.2 KB SVG output, no JS, no external fonts, opens in any browser

Inputs (YAML or JSON)

problem: "NPT on cementing operations exceeded target by 77% (14.2h vs 8h budget over 6 months)"
categories:
  - name: "Man (People)"
    causes:
      - "Crew experience varies across shifts (IWCF L4 only on day shift)"
      - "Night-shift cementer callout delays average 90 min"
  - name: "Machine (Equipment)"
    causes:
      - "Cement unit #3 pressure sensor drift (last cal 14 months ago)"
      - "Recirculating mixer wear above manufacturer spec"
  - name: "Material"
    causes:
      - "Class G cement lot inconsistency (2 of 5 recent lots failed thickening time)"
      - "Anti-gas additive settling in storage tanks (no agitation log)"
  - name: "Method (Process)"
    causes:
      - "Pre-job checklist skipped on rushed operations (8 of 12 jobs)"
      - "Pump schedule not adjusted for actual BHCT  uses plan number"
  - name: "Measurement"
    causes:
      - "Pressure test results not logged in real time"
      - "Lab thickening-time tests run at 100°F, field BHCT often 180°F+"
  - name: "Environment"
    causes:
      - "Ambient temps >40°C affect additive performance"
      - "Well site layout forces 45m hose run, adds 8 min circulation time"

Pairs with

  • skill-dmaic-template — Use Fishbone in the Analyze phase of a DMAIC project.
  • skill-pareto — Use Pareto to identify the vital few causes to put on the fishbone.
